About Beacon House

Since 1997, Beacon House in Louisville, Kentucky, has provided transitional housing for men dealing with substance use disorder including those transitioning out of incarceration. Operating under their three pillars of spirituality, living, and health, they offer a high level of support, structure, and accountability while allowing residents to maintain employment and connection with the outside community.

Referrals to Community Services

After completing inpatient care or the equivalent while incarcerated, transitional housing provides peer support and referrals to continuing recovery programs. I noticed these can include intensive outpatient programs (IOP), individual or family counseling, psychiatric evaluations and general healthcare, and even Vivitrol for medication assisted treatment (MAT).

Specialized Services for Recovery in Louisville

Opened by a Louisville couple looking for a local sober residential option for their son, the facility now boasts space for 50 recovering men. Providing structured housing with onsite case management, they envision themselves as more than just a halfway house. Embracing the values of fostering hope, treating with dignity, showing compassion, being accountable, and having a foundation of spirituality, they recognize that the real work begins upon leaving inpatient treatment.

Beacon House provides a transitional living model and life skills programming to prepare residents for sober living. I like how they partner with inpatient organizations across Kentucky, the department of corrections, and other chemical dependency professionals to offer paths for sober lives of meaning and dignity.
